Output d7166639fe61d808c3dc52dd51ab52cc526f705cfab5a12d66ae6501c2b9e6f8:1

value
2122771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9917568fd2bd7779c270f2c2e8ebe53f5e5944e0 OP_EQUAL
address
3FeVGTP4pvX2L7zFzfMTAd6R2t8m2bW1GJ
transaction
d7166639fe61d808c3dc52dd51ab52cc526f705cfab5a12d66ae6501c2b9e6f8
spent
true